Comradebot Posted July 31, 2009 Share Posted July 31, 2009 It's really up to you, but at 40 and 10+ years past their prime they could retire at any moment... or they could keep working. I believe Doctor Insane was 10 years past his prime when I signed him at the start of the game, and over three years later he's still an active wrestler. So, as I said, the choice is yours. You could gamble that they'll stay useful (or perhaps you plan to keep them post-retirement), or you could start moving them down the card so younger guys can move up, and after that you could either allow them to continue working in the midcard or release them. It'll probably come down to an individual basis for every case. Sean McFly 10 years past his prime is still going to be a fantastic worker, so maybe you'd keep him at the top and let him end his career there. Runaway Train, however, will start to lose his Menace (easily his most useful stat), so it seems unlikely he'll be justifiable to keep at the top. Bigpapa42 Posted July 31, 2009 Share Posted July 31, 2009 Depends on what your needs are. Guys can have plenty of value after they retire. Someone with good Entertainment skills could be a manager, commentator, etc. Someone with very good in-ring skills might do well as a Road Agent or as a trainer in development. If they don't have any use to you anymore, then I would say let the contracts expire. But if they have some value and money isn't an issue, keep them around.
